Moniker Posted March 28, 2023 #1 Share Posted March 28, 2023 My DH and I have decided to go for the Princess Plus package for our very short 3 day cruise down the Pacific Coast. We have a hefty OBC thanks to travelling with kids - a total of $400 USD for our cabin. We want to use some of the OBC to cover our Princess Plus package. We still have 30+ days before we embark. I'm wondering, if we go ahead and add Plus to our booking now, can we use our OBC to cover it? Or do we have to wait until we board the boat and them add Plus? If the latter, how do we do this and is it still the same cost of $60 USD/person/day? Thanks for your help!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

If the latter, how do we do this and is it still the same cost of $60 USD/person/day? Thanks for your help! You have to be on board to use the obc to pay for Plus. Iirc you can buy it through the app, once on board, or go to customer services. Cost remains at $60pppd.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
happy42cruise Posted March 28, 2023 #3 Share Posted March 28, 2023 Also keep in mind if you purchase before you are onboard it may raise your fare and/or your vacation protection cost if you purchased that. Just something to watch out for. 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
